What is Invisalign?

Invisalign is an innovative orthodontic treatment that uses a series of custom made, clear plastic aligners to gradually move your teeth into their ideal position. Unlike traditional metal braces, Invisalign aligners are virtually invisible, offering a discreet way to achieve a straighter smile.


Each set of aligners is worn for around two weeks before moving onto the next, gently guiding your teeth into alignment over time. They are removable, making it easier to eat, brush and floss without the restrictions that come with fixed braces. Invisalign is suitable for a wide range of dental concerns, including crowding, gaps, overbites, underbites and more.

Is There Aftercare for Invisalign?

Caring for your Invisalign aligners is essential for successful treatment. You’ll need to clean your aligners daily to maintain hygiene and avoid discolouration. Brushing and flossing your teeth before reinserting the aligners is important to prevent plaque build-up.


Some common side effects include mild discomfort as your teeth adjust, but this usually subsides quickly. We offer ongoing support and regular check-ups to address any concerns and ensure your treatment progresses as planned. After treatment, wearing a retainer can help maintain your newly aligned smile.   • What is Invisalign made from?

    Invisalign aligners are made from SmartTrack®, a patented, medical-grade thermoplastic material. This material is designed to be comfortable, durable and virtually invisible, providing an effective yet discreet orthodontic solution for a range of dental alignment issues.

  • How long does Invisalign treatment take?

    The duration of Invisalign treatment can vary depending on your specific dental needs. On average, treatment may take 12–18 months, but some cases can be shorter or longer. Your orthodontist will provide an estimated timeline during your consultation.

  • Are Invisalign aligners removable?

    Yes, Invisalign aligners are removable. You can take them out for eating, drinking, brushing, and flossing. However, for the best results, they should be worn for 20–22 hours per day, as instructed by your orthodontist.

  • Are there any side effects with Invisalign?

    Common side effects include mild discomfort or pressure during the initial adjustment period, which is a sign the aligners are working. Some patients may experience temporary changes in speech or increased saliva production, but these effects typically subside as you adjust to wearing the aligners.
